What are the types of communication research?

Communication Research Methods. In the field of communication, there are three main research methodologies: quantitative, qualitative, and rhetorical . As communication students progress in their careers, they will likely find themselves using one of these far more often than the others.

What is elements of communication?

The communication process involves understanding, sharing, and meaning, and it consists of eight essential elements: source, message, channel, receiver, feedback, environment, context, and interference .

What is the importance of qualitative research in the field of communication?

While researchers who use quantitative approaches tend to value prediction and control as potential outcomes of their research, those who use qualitative approaches seek greater understanding of human communication phenomena, or evaluate current pragmatic uses of human communication to help identify and change ...
